Description:

Manufactured in 1905, with the scarce and desirable 7 1/2 inch barrel chambered in the always desirable .45 LC caliber. The top of the barrel is marked with the standard two-line address and patent dates, and the left side has the model and caliber marking. The side plate has the model marking around the Rampant Colt. The left side of the trigger guard has a Colt "V" proof and the number "5." A lanyard loop is mounted on the butt. The revolver wears a set of pearl grips with a relief carved eagle and shield motif on the right panel. The included factory letter states the revolver was sold to L.S. Lester (address unavailable) and shipped to Hibbard, Spencer, Bartlett & Co. of Chicago, Illinois, on December 2, 1905 with a 7 1/2 inch barrel in .45 caliber, blue finish, and pearl stocks with American Eagle motif. This was a single gun shipment. Provenance: The Charles Marx Collection

Rating Definition:

Excellent, retaining 95% plus bright original high polish blue finish with some muzzle and edge wear and some thinning to brown on the grip straps. The grips are also excellent with a slight surface chip near the bottom (left panel), highly attractive fiery colors, and crisp carving. Mechanically excellent.
